How do I Change the Auger in a Craftsman 9-Horsepower Snowblower?

Changing the auger on a Craftsman 9 horsepower snow thrower may be required if you have damaged the auger blades by repeated contact with immovable objects. The auger blade is normally protected from damage by 2 shear pins, which allow the auger to immediately stop rotating when an obstruction is hit. When an immovable object is struck, 2 shear pins will immediately break and allow the auger to halt. Always replace the shear pins when changing the auger blades as added protection from unintended auger damage.
